Ticket: Config drift on Chalkrow timetable solver. Production solver nodes diverged from the declared baseline sometime last sprint — two nodes accept unsigned constraint files, one has verbose debug logging enabled. Security impact: possible leakage of student schedule data in logs. Requesting review before we re-converge. The current values observed on the drifted nodes are recorded below.

deployment values, yadug-bawif:
[framir]
team = pelox
access_code = ac_a38ab2
owner = tamion.julael
host = framir.tolvaqlabs.test
port = 11211
peer = tammir.zemvargrid.local
salt = 2215ef03
pin = 1541

Ticket: Vault lockout blocking formula sandbox release. The Fernwheel vault holding the sandbox signing certificate auto-locked after three failed unseal attempts. Plugin authors: user-supplied formulas remain sandboxed under the Lattice interpreter; no escape is possible, but new plugin submissions are paused until the vault is reopened. Do not ship workarounds that evaluate formulas outside the sandbox. Resolution requires the on-call steward to re-unseal with the stored recovery phrase, which is appended below for the steward's use.

strongbox words: jorix-norys-aldius-druax

RUNBOOK — SEALED EXAM PAPERS, BRIDDOCK TESTING CENTRE

Shift lead procedure: exam cartons from Hallowmere Print arrive banded and shrink-wrapped. Verify carton count against the manifest, check every security seal, and quarantine any carton with a broken seal — do not repack it. Cartons are stored in cage 3 under lock until dispatch. Only the named driver from Fennet Secure Transit collects; no relief drivers accepted. The confidential hand-over instruction for the courier follows on the next line.

courier memo of yahif-faweg: the quenael tamius courier leaves the prawyn jorix kaswyn istox silmir brieth zormir fenvan ledger at gate 3145 under passcode 231062